#efe98f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#efe98f is composed of 93.7% red, 91.4%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.5%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 56.3 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 74.9%. #efe98f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#dfd31f. Closest websafe color is: #ffff99.

Shades and Tints of #efe98f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080801 is the darkest color, while #fefd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#efe98f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3c2bb is the less saturated color, while #fef680 is the most saturated one.
